The pharmacy’s main role is to prepare and dispense drugs and medicines. With medicine becoming increasingly more complex as does the role performed by the pharmacy. A Pharmacist is responsible for maintaining the established departmental policies, procedures and objectives to ensure the pharmacy fulfils its role. Hospital Pharmacists can be assigned to work in the Outpatient Pharmacy, In-Patient Pharmacy or Mid-Atlantic Wellness Institute Pharmacy. All Pharmacists participate in shift rotation, including weekends, public holidays and on-call. Pharmacists participate in a variety of continuing education sessions and are a part of the Multidisciplinary team for patient care. Pharmacists interact with nurses, doctors and other health professionals on a regular basis ensuring patients receive the most appropriate medicines in the most effective way.
